llgd.net
当前位置:首页 >> js用延时型定时器做一个从5开始,到0结束的倒计时... >>

js用延时型定时器做一个从5开始,到0结束的倒计时...

var div=document.createElement("div");div.innerHTML="5";document.body.appendChild(div);var timer=setInterval(function(){ --div.innerHTML==0&&(clearInterval(timer),alert("时间到了"));}, 1000);ok,代码简单易懂

我简单写了个 你看看 var count = 11;function time(){count--;if(count

var s = 60, t; function times(){ s--; document.form.time.value = s; t = setTimeout('times', 1000); if ( s

div显示时间2秒后就自动消失: 一秒=2000 function codefans(){var box=document.getElementById("divbox");box.style.display="none"; }setTimeout("codefans()",2000);//2秒,可以改动

你把setTimeout包装下就好 然後在调用你包装的函数时记录当前时间, 并计算出要达到的时间 之後启动定时器, 并在触发定时时重新获取当前时间, 算出正确的差距, 如果没到指定时间就再次设定定时器 为了防止你从锁屏切回来後倒计时变动延迟过大, 你...

#include #include #define uint unsigned int #define uchar unsigned char uchar Timer=0; uchar code table[]={0x3f,0x06,0x05,0x4f,0x66,0x6d,0x7d,0x07,0x7f,0x6f,0x77,0x7c,0x39,0x5e,0x79,0x71}; uchar code tablewe[]={0x00,0x01,0x02,0...

一般我们用定时器来做计时器,实现时间得加。每次中断发生,用一个变量自增来判断时间是否到1S,到了之后清零这个变量,另一个时间变量自增来作时间得增加。现在就是要把这个自增的时间变量改为自减,判断当小于0时,又赋初值,然后继续自减判断...

页面显示虽然停止 但是js可以做到点完确定按钮后 减去用户操作提示框的时间 当弹出alert的时候 记录当前时间 当点击确定按钮后,再记录当前时间 相减得出 消耗时间 倒计时剩余时间减去消耗时间=继续倒计时时间

使用 监听事件监听 鼠标进入 时间那个div,然后删除定时器,再鼠标移开的事件里写代码再重新启动定时器。 --itjob

#include #define uint unsigned int #define uchar unsigned char uchar a,num,wela;//wela是数码管位选信号 uchar code temp[ ]={0xc0,0xf9,0xa4,0xb0,0x99,0x92,0x82,0xf8,0x80,0x90};//共阳极数码管显示 //声明延时函数 void delay(uint z) ...

网站首页 | 网站地图
All rights reserved Powered by www.llgd.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com